Growing chili’s

I enjoy cooking quite a bit and love nothing more than adding fresh chili, garlic, rosemary along with many other garnishes and herbs to my dishes.

So I was quite pleased this Christmas when Freya got me lots of different types of chili seeds to grow my own chili’s. I planted them Christmas day as I knew the longer you leave the packet seeds the less likely they were to grow.

I planted 5 different types of chili seed in one large container which I have to keep indoors over winter. While I was away in Wales I got my parents to water them for me. Now only 10 days later I can see at least 6 seedlings popping up. So I am naturally very pleased. There is something extremely exciting and satisfying about growing your own food and plants.
